4H-1,3,2-Benzodioxaphosphorin,2-methoxy-, 2-sulfide cas no:3811-49-2

Synonyms: Phosphorothioicacid, O-methyl ester, cyclic O,O-ester with o-hydroxybenzyl alcohol (7CI);Phosphorothioic acid, cyclic O,O-(methylene-o-phenylene) O-methyl ester (8CI);Benzyl alcohol, o-hydroxy-, cyclic O,O-ester with O-methyl phosphorothioate(8CI); 2-Methoxy-4H-1,3,2-benzodioxaphorphorin-2-sulfide;2-Methoxy-4H-1,3,2-benzodioxaphospholin-2-sulfide; 2-Methoxy-4H-1,3,2-benzodioxaphosphorin-2-sulfide;Dioxabenzofos; Dioxabenzophos; Fenfosphorin; Saligenin cyclic methylphosphorothionate; Salithion

Identification
Name4H-1,3,2-Benzodioxaphosphorin,2-methoxy-, 2-sulfide
CAS3811-49-2
SynonymsPhosphorothioicacid, O-methyl ester, cyclic O,O-ester with o-hydroxybenzyl alcohol (7CI);Phosphorothioic acid, cyclic O,O-(methylene-o-phenylene) O-methyl ester (8CI);Benzyl alcohol, o-hydroxy-, cyclic O,O-ester with O-methyl phosphorothioate(8CI); 2-Methoxy-4H-1,3,2-benzodioxaphorphorin-2-sulfide;2-Methoxy-4H-1,3,2-benzodioxaphospholin-2-sulfide; 2-Methoxy-4H-1,3,2-benzodioxaphosphorin-2-sulfide;Dioxabenzofos; Dioxabenzophos; Fenfosphorin; Saligenin cyclic methylphosphorothionate; Salithion
EINECS(EC#)223-292-3
Molecular FormulaC8H9 O3 P S
Molecular Weight216.20
Chemical Properties
refractive index1.59
storage temp0-6°C

Safety Data

Hazard T: Toxic;N: Dangerous for the environment;
Risk 24/25-39/25-51/53
Safety

Poison by ingestion, skin contact, and subcutaneous routes. Mutation data reported. An insecticide. When heated to decomposition it emits very toxic fumes of SOx and POx. See also PARATHION.

Toxicity

Organism Test Type Route Reported Dose (Normalized Dose) Effect Source
chicken LD50 oral 110mg/kg (110mg/kg) PERIPHERAL NERVE AND SENSATION: STRUCTURAL CHANGE IN NERVE OR SHEATH

BEHAVIORAL: ATAXIA
Bochu Kagaku. Scientific Pest Control. Vol. 40, Pg. 49, 1975.
mouse LD50 oral 88mg/kg (88mg/kg)   Agricultural and Biological Chemistry. Vol. 29, Pg. 243, 1965.
mouse LD50 skin > 1250mg/kg (1250mg/kg)   Pesticide Manual. Vol. 9, Pg. 308, 1991.
mouse LD50 subcutaneous 81600ug/kg (81.6mg/kg)   Japan Pesticide Information. Vol. (2), Pg. 30, 1970.
rat LD50 oral 102mg/kg (102mg/kg)   Pesticides. Vol. 15, Pg. 3, 1981.
rat LD50 skin 400mg/kg (400mg/kg)   Farm Chemicals Handbook. Vol. -, Pg. C268, 1991.
